I know what you’re going through. I’ve been seeing therapists for years who diagnosed and prescribed all sorts of things without ever thinking about ADHD. It seemed like everything just made sense when ADHD was suggested. And my reaction to the stimulant medication (it does a little bit to calm me down and focus) seems to verify that.

Finding the right treatment is confusing and baffling enough without ADHD. It seems like days and weeks and months of trial and error, making discoveries without any assistance from professionals whatsoever. I do believe that proper treatment consists of therapy and medication (though medication does not work for all – I can only tolerate a little). It’s a challenge.

But one helpful phrase comes to mind: “Keep climbing. You may never reach the top, but at least you’re headed in the right direction.” As long as you are working to help yourself get better, you are doing the right thing.
